Chapter 561: Fierce Offensive
Meanwhile, outside Gaoling City, a siege battle was unfolding.
Unlike the small houses within the city that matched their height, the naturally timid Goblins had built Gaoling City’s walls incredibly tall and imposing to ensure their lives were protected.
Most exaggeratedly, to accommodate as many defensive siege weapons as possible, the city walls were absurdly wide, even exceeding the scale of Mirror City’s walls.
Heaven knows how much manpower and resources Gawain had expended on this city wall.
If not for the Goblin Civilization being a special civilization known for its technical and scientific prowess, a regular civilization at that stage simply could not have built such a city wall.
It could truly be said to be the crystallization of their Goblin Civilization’s technological capability.
Facing such a city wall, Zhang Zhenguo, the invading player, felt his psychological pressure mounting even before the battle began.
However, he was, after all, a veteran who had been struggling in the Bronze tier for decades.
He would not be deterred by such a spectacle.
His civilization urgently needed a large amount of resources.
Previously, he had continuously fought four or five novice players, yet despite exhausting himself, he hadn’t plundered many resources.
In one of those battles, even though he won, the returns felt like a loss.
In other words, those weaklings in the Bronze tier had been squeezed almost dry.
Continuing to fight them wouldn’t yield many resources.
Thus, helpless but in urgent need of resources, he could only set his sights on targets that were not easily provoked.
Although Luo Ji had been gaining significant momentum recently, compared to the powerful figures who had consistently dominated the top 200 rankings for years, he was, after all, a newcomer.
Zhang Zhenguo surmised that Luo Ji’s foundation was still shallow and could likely be exploited.
Ultimately, among a collection of difficult targets, Luo Ji was still picked out as the softest one to squeeze.
This wave of invasion, although Zhang Zhenguo hadn’t sent his entire force, was still a fierce offensive.
He was clearly desperate due to his civilization’s urgent resource shortage.
He directly dispatched 5,000 troops to hold the line, along with 7 siege weapons.
It was completely a stance of ‘I will bite off a piece of flesh from you no matter what!’
The military formation, consisting of 5,000 troops, quickly spread out.
The 7 siege weapons began to be pushed forward from the rear.
Guo Zhen, observing the movements outside the city through his telescope, showed a hint of solemnity on his face.
The enemy’s siege formation was quite grand.
He looked back at the wide city wall beneath his feet, almost wide enough for horse racing, and the defensive siege weapons manufactured by Goblin Tech on top of it.
Guo Zhen’s confidence slightly increased.
Although these siege weapons would largely become useless once the distance closed, they could at least inflict considerable damage on the enemy from afar.
Guo Zhen entrusted all operations of the siege weapons to Gaoling City’s Goblin soldiers.
In a direct confrontation on the battlefield, these short and slender Goblin soldiers were vulnerable.
However, when it came to operating these large military machines, they were exceptionally skilled, each moving swiftly and efficiently.
As soon as the enemy entered range, the catapults and triple-bow crossbows on the city wall immediately began bombarding the area outside the city.
The entire process didn’t require Guo Zhen to utter a single word, because the Goblin Civilization had previously relied on this very method to forcefully deter invading players!
This relentless bombardment immediately crippled half of the 7 siege weapons the enemy had pushed forward.
Zhang Zhenguo, located in the rear, felt his heart wrench.
“Damn it! How many defensive military machines does the enemy have on that city wall?”
If it were an unranked novice, or a newcomer who had just risen to the Bronze tier, facing such a display would likely deter them instantly.
But facing a veteran like Zhang Zhenguo, who had witnessed all sorts of strategies, deterring him so easily was no longer possible.
Not to mention, this trip alone cost him at least hundreds of thousands in military expenses; how could he simply retreat?
Indeed, the enemy had no intention of withdrawing.
Accompanied by the sound of an attack horn, the enemy responded to the challenge.
4,000 troops quickly dispersed into small square formations, significantly reducing the hit rate of the catapults and triple-bow crossbows.
Then, with large shield soldiers leading the way, the siege units in the rear carried scaling ladders and pushed siege towers, rapidly launching an assault on Gaoling City!
Guo Zhen’s heart sank upon seeing this.
“Archer units, prepare!”
Then, he seized the moment the enemy’s siege units entered range.
“Fire!!”
Volleys of arrows rained down on the area outside the city, one after another.
But the enemy’s siege units were incredibly tenacious, maintaining their shield-raised advancing posture, moving step by step closer to Gaoling City’s gate!
After advancing a certain distance, the enemy’s archer units also retaliated, beginning to shoot arrows towards Gaoling City’s walls.
Guo Zhen, holding a large bronze shield and having successively blocked two volleys of arrows, gritted his teeth.
With the limited troops he had, he simply could not stop the enemy siege units’ advance.
Judging by the situation, a close-quarters battle was unavoidable.
The disparity in troop numbers was too great, so charging out would clearly mean no chance of victory.
Thus, they could only fiercely defend the city walls!
Seeing the enemy about to push up to the city wall, Guo Zhen quickly waved his hand, signaling the soldiers on the wall to move the rolling logs and boulders and hurl them down.
At the same time, he loudly shouted.
“Keep a close eye on all sections of the wall! Don’t let the enemy set up their scaling ladders!”
Guo Zhen held a shield in one hand and an axe in the other, resembling a formidable guardian who could hold off 10,000 men.
With such a fierce general defending one section of the wall, it would be incredibly difficult for ordinary soldiers to charge up.
The other soldiers focused on fiercely defending the remaining sections.
For a time, the battle was extremely fierce.
Outside the city walls, a man wearing light armor with a long sword at his waist pondered for a moment, then turned to Zhang Zhenguo and spoke.
“Your Majesty, the enemy’s defending forces are fighting tenaciously. It is likely difficult to capture this city wall today. Perhaps we should temporarily retreat, rest, and fight another day.”
Hearing this, Zhang Zhenguo, clad in bronze armor, looked grim.
“Fight another day? Strategist, you know we have no time left!”
He had done something foolish before, which directly led to his civilization’s resources falling into an extremely scarce state.
His previous few invasions had targeted small fry, and the resources plundered were barely a drop in the bucket.
In other words, if he couldn’t plunder a large amount of resources to fill this void, he would collapse!
How could he not be anxious?
Looking at the distraught Zhang Zhenguo, the man referred to as the Strategist sighed inwardly, then spoke again.
“Your Majesty, haste makes waste. The enemy’s defending forces have consumed a large amount of defensive resources in this battle. When we fight again next time, it will certainly be much easier. Furthermore, as the saying goes, ‘The spirit is roused at the first drum, slackens at the second, and is exhausted at the third.’ Our army’s morale is low now. Continuing to fight will bring no chance of victory, only increasing casualties.”
“Temporarily retreating and fighting another day is the best strategy.”
